# Installation ## Prequisites Before proceeding with the installation you need to make sure you have installed: - Python 3.13 with PIP - Docker Engine (Docker desktop on windows) - Docker Compose (Bundled with modern Docker Desktop installations) ## Methods There are two methods of installing this APP: - [Python Package](#python-package) - [Building from source](#build-from-source) ## Python Package ```{note} This is the recommended method ``` You can simply install the package via PIP since the APP is published on [pypi](https://pypi.org/project/MinecraftDockerCLI/). We recommend to create a virtual environment for installing the package, although you can always install it in your root python install.
To install the package in virtual environment you should run the following commands: ``` python3 -m venv .venv ./.venv/Scripts/activate pip install MinecraftDockerCLI ``` ## Build from source For building from source you need to follow the next steps: - Clone the repo either downloading it from the github page or by running:
`git clone https://github.com/Dtar380/MinecraftDockerCLI.git` - Enter the folder of the repository you cloned and run:
`python -m pip install -e` ```{warning} Do not errase the code from the cloned repository since the APP will be running from that source code ```
